The Vietnam Microspheres Market is projected to witness mixed growth rate patterns during 2025 to 2029. The growth rate begins at 13.65% in 2025, climbs to a high of 15.49% in 2027, and moderates to 12.91% by 2029.

By 2027, the Microspheres market in Vietnam is anticipated to reach a growth rate of 15.49%, as part of an increasingly competitive Asia region, where China remains at the forefront, supported by India, Japan, Australia and South Korea, driving innovations and market adoption across sectors.

The Vietnam Microspheres market is witnessing a surge in demand across various industries, including construction, healthcare, and automotive. Microspheres, characterized by their small size and uniform structure, find applications in areas such as lightweight fillers, medical technology, and paints and coatings. The construction sector is a key driver of market growth, as microspheres enhance the performance of construction materials. Moreover, the automotive industry`s increasing emphasis on lightweight materials to improve fuel efficiency is propelling the adoption of microspheres in manufacturing. The market is dynamic, with continuous research and development activities aimed at introducing new and improved microsphere products.

The Vietnam Microspheres market is confronted with several challenges that impact its growth and sustainability. One notable challenge is the increasing cost of raw materials, leading to heightened production expenses. The market also faces regulatory hurdles, including compliance with stringent quality standards and environmental regulations. Additionally, the competition within the microspheres industry has intensified, putting pressure on companies to innovate and differentiate their products. Market players are grappling with the need for continuous research and development to stay ahead in the rapidly evolving landscape. Furthermore, fluctuations in the global economy and uncertainties related to trade policies pose additional risks to the Vietnam Microspheres market, requiring strategic adaptation to mitigate these external factors.
The Vietnam microspheres market, like many others, faced significant challenges during the COVID-19 pandemic. The unprecedented global crisis disrupted supply chains and manufacturing processes, leading to a slowdown in production. The construction and automotive industries, major consumers of microspheres, experienced declines as projects were delayed or put on hold. The market also witnessed a shift in consumer behavior, impacting demand for certain products. Despite these challenges, the microspheres market in Vietnam showed resilience, adapting to new norms and gradually recovering as economic activities resumed.
The Microspheres market in Vietnam has witnessed the active participation of key players offering innovative solutions. Potters Industries LLC has made a mark with its diverse range of microspheres catering to different industries. 3M Company is another significant player, leveraging its expertise to provide high-performance microspheres for various applications. Additionally, Trelleborg AB contributes to the market with its specialized microsphere products, addressing the evolving needs of industries in Vietnam.
